import { Project } from '../types/project-config.js'; import * as fs from 'fs-extra'; import * as path from 'path'; import Handlebars from 'handlebars'; export interface GeneratorOptions { outputDir: string; overwrite?: boolean; dryRun?: boolean; } export class ProjectGenerateError extends Error { constructor(message: string, public details?: any) { super(message); this.name = 'ProjectGenerateError'; } } export class ProjectGenerator { private project: Project; private options: GeneratorOptions; constructor(project: Project, options: GeneratorOptions) { this.project = project; this.options = options; } /** * Generate the complete project structure */ async generate(): Promise<void> { try { await this.validateOptions(); await this.createDirectories(); await this.generateFiles(); await this.generateConfigurationFiles(); } catch (error) { if (error instanceof Error) { throw new ProjectGenerateError(`Generation failed: ${error.message}`, error); } throw error; } } /** * Generate project configuration as JSON */ static generateJson(project: Project, pretty: boolean = true): string { return JSON.stringify(project, null, pretty ? 2 : 0); } /** * Save project configuration to file */ static async saveToFile(project: Project, filePath: string, pretty: boolean = true): Promise<void> { const json = this.generateJson(project, pretty); await fs.ensureDir(path.dirname(filePath)); await fs.writeFile(filePath, json, 'utf-8'); } private async validateOptions(): Promise<void> { if (!this.options.outputDir) { throw new ProjectGenerateError('Output directory is required'); } if (await fs.pathExists(this.options.outputDir) && !this.options.overwrite) { const files = await fs.readdir(this.options.outputDir); if (files.length > 0) { throw new ProjectGenerateError( `Output directory ${this.options.outputDir} is not empty. Use --overwrite to force.` ); } } } private async createDirectories(): Promise<void> { const { directories } = this.project.structure; for (const dir of directories) { const fullPath = path.join(this.options.outputDir, dir); if (this.options.dryRun) { console.log(`[DRY RUN] Would create directory: ${fullPath}`); } else { await fs.ensureDir(fullPath); console.log(`Created directory: ${fullPath}`); } } } private async generateFiles(): Promise<void> { const { files } = this.project.structure; for (const file of files) { const fullPath = path.join(this.options.outputDir, file); if (this.options.dryRun) { console.log(`[DRY RUN] Would create file: ${fullPath}`); } else { await fs.ensureDir(path.dirname(fullPath)); // Generate file content based on file type const content = await this.generateFileContent(file); await fs.writeFile(fullPath, content, 'utf-8'); console.log(`Created file: ${fullPath}`); } } } private async generateConfigurationFiles(): Promise<void> { const { configurations } = this.project; for (const [fileName, lines] of Object.entries(configurations)) { const fullPath = path.join(this.options.outputDir, fileName); const content = lines.join('\n'); if (this.options.dryRun) { console.log(`[DRY RUN] Would create configuration file: ${fullPath}`); } else { await fs.ensureDir(path.dirname(fullPath)); await fs.writeFile(fullPath, content, 'utf-8'); console.log(`Created configuration file: ${fullPath}`); } } } private async generateFileContent(fileName: string): Promise<string> { const { projectConfig, dependencies } = this.project; // Basic template context const context = { projectName: projectConfig.name, description: projectConfig.description, language: projectConfig.language, framework: projectConfig.framework, dependencies, packageName: this.getPackageName(projectConfig.name), className: this.getClassName(projectConfig.name), }; // Generate content based on file type if (fileName.endsWith('.java')) { return this.generateJavaFile(fileName, context); } else if (fileName === 'pom.xml') { return this.generatePomXml(context); } else if (fileName === 'build.gradle') { return this.generateBuildGradle(context); } else if (fileName.endsWith('.md')) { return this.generateMarkdownFile(fileName, context); } return `// Generated file: ${fileName}\n// TODO: Implement content for ${fileName}`; } private generateJavaFile(fileName: string, context: any): string { if (fileName.includes('Application.java')) { return this.generateSpringBootApplication(context); } return `package ${context.packageName};\n\n// TODO: Implement ${fileName}`; } private generateSpringBootApplication(context: any): string { const template = `package {{packageName}}; import org.springframework.boot.SpringApplication; import org.springframework.boot.autoconfigure.SpringBootApplication; /** * {{description}} */ @SpringBootApplication public class {{className}}Application { public static void main(String[] args) { SpringApplication.run({{className}}Application.class, args); } }`; return Handlebars.compile(template)(context); } private generatePomXml(context: any): string { const template = `<?xml version="1.0" encoding="UTF-8"?> <project xmlns="http://maven.apache.org/POM/4.0.0"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d"> <modelVersion>4.0.0</modelVersion> <groupId>com.example</groupId> <artifactId>{{projectName}}</artifactId> <version>0.0.1-SNAPSHOT</version> <packaging>jar</packaging> <name>{{projectName}}</name> <description>{{description}}</description> <parent> <groupId>org.springframework.boot</groupId> <artifactId>spring-boot-starter-parent</artifactId> <version>3.0.0</version> <relativePath/> </parent> <properties> <java.version>11</java.version> </properties> <dependencies> {{#each dependencies}} <dependency> <groupId>org.springframework.boot</groupId> <artifactId>{{@key}}</artifactId> <version>{{this}}</version> </dependency> {{/each}} </dependencies> <build> <plugins> <plugin> <groupId>org.springframework.boot</groupId> <artifactId>spring-boot-maven-plugin</artifactId> </plugin> </plugins> </build> </project>`; return Handlebars.compile(template)(context); } private generateBuildGradle(context: any): string { const template = `plugins { id 'java' id 'org.springframework.boot' version '3.0.0' id 'io.spring.dependency-management' version '1.1.0' } group = 'com.example' version = '0.0.1-SNAPSHOT' sourceCompatibility = '11' repositories { mavenCentral() } dependencies { {{#each dependencies}} implementation '{{@key}}:{{this}}' {{/each}} } tasks.named('test') { useJUnitPlatform() }`; return Handlebars.compile(template)(context); } private generateMarkdownFile(fileName: string, context: any): string { if (fileName.toLowerCase() === 'readme.md') { const template = `# {{projectName}} {{description}} ## Features - Microservice architecture - Spring Boot 3.0 - RESTful API - Database integration - Docker support ## Getting Started ### Prerequisites - Java 11 or higher - Maven 3.6 or higher - Docker (optional) ### Running the application \`\`\`bash mvn spring-boot:run \`\`\` ### Building for production \`\`\`bash mvn clean package \`\`\` ### Docker \`\`\`bash docker build -t {{projectName}} . docker run -p 8080:8080 {{projectName}} \`\`\` ## API Documentation The API documentation is available at: http://localhost:8080/swagger-ui.html ## License This project is licensed under the MIT License.`; return Handlebars.compile(template)(context); } return `# ${fileName}\n\nTODO: Add content for ${fileName}`; } private getPackageName(projectName: string): string { return `com.example.${projectName.toLowerCase().replace(/-/g, '')}`; } private getClassName(projectName: string): string { return projectName .split('-') .map(word => word.charAt(0).toUpperCase() + word.slice(1).toLowerCase()) .join(''); } }
